I have those headlights. I like them and it doesn't take much to make them look like that but you will need to fab up a wiring harness for them. My old headlights were cracked from the previous owner so i just took the harness out of them and used it to make them work. Also the halo was hooked up to my parking lights for about 3 weeks then it went out. I didn't feel like replaceing it so i disconnected them. I'm ordering some hopefully in a couple weeks off of ebay for like 150 shipped. Don't spend $200 on them just get them from ebay. I Forgot take a lot of time to aim them correctly because the light output is not that great and i have upgraded bulbs.
 
stay away from APC/Gen 3 headlights. They look awesome, of course, but the quality is pretty nasty. They are 200 dollars for a reason. I bought them for my old civic and the Halo ring burnt out on one of them. To replace it you have to deal with opening up the cover and replacing it with another LED light. Plus you have to adjust them, the light output isnt great. Sure you will look cool, but then your halo will burn out, then your low-beam, and then you wont be able to see in the dark. Im telling you this from experience. The only brand that is good and people seem to agree on is TYC. I heard nothing good about projectors over time.
